From: František Dvořák Date: Thu, 27 Aug 2015 13:15:12 +0000 (+0200) Subject: Add default python provide on EPEL 6. X-Git-Url: http://scientific.zcu.cz/git/?a=commitdiff_plain;h=2e16cc457d496a93d7d29ce0c3e585da48e2b6f1;p=packaging-rpm-pOCCI.git Add default python provide on EPEL 6. --- diff --git a/python-pOCCI.spec b/python-pOCCI.spec index 40fc865..fb9718e 100644 --- a/python-pOCCI.spec +++ b/python-pOCCI.spec @@ -9,17 +9,20 @@ %{!?py3_install:%global py3_install %{__python3} setup.py install -O1 --skip-build --root %{buildroot}} %if 0%{?rhel} && 0%{?rhel} <= 6 %{!?__python2: %global __python2 /usr/bin/python2} +%{!?python_provide: %global python_provide Provides: python-%{srcname} = %{version}-%{release}} %{!?python2_version: %global python2_version %(%{__python2} -c "import sys; sys.stdout.write(sys.version[:3])")} %{!?python2_sitelib: %global python2_sitelib %(%{__python2} -c "from distutils.sysconfig import get_python_lib; print(get_python_lib())")} %{!?python2_sitearch: %global python2_sitearch %(%{__python2} -c "from distutils.sysconfig import get_python_lib; print(get_python_lib(1))")} %endif +# no python 3 in EL <= 7 %if 0%{?rhel} %global with_python3 0 %else %global with_python3 1 %endif +# incompatible unittest module in EL <= 6 %if 0%{?rhel} && 0%{?rhel} <= 6 %global with_tests 0 %else